LG has started sending out invites for the launch event of the G4 on April 28th in New York, London and Paris, and on April 29th in Singapore, Istanbul and Seoul.

The invite carries the tagline “See The Great. Feel The Great,” with the background resembling leather.

An LG executive had earlier stated that LG will be launching the G4 in April with a new UI/UX and design. However, alleged leaked photos of the handset show a device that looks similar to the G3 in design as well as the UI/UX department.

The LG G4 apparently made an appearance in GFXBench’s database earlier today that revealed some of the specs of the handset, which includes a 7MP front-facing camera and a Quad HD display. The benchmark suite also suggests that LG is going to use the Snapdragon 808 processor inside the G4, and not the problematic Snapdragon 810, which is prone to overheating leading to poor battery life.
